Geert Uytterhoeven wrote:
> On Thu, 30 Oct 2003, Manousaridis Angelos wrote:
>
>>Is it possible with a 2.4.xx kernel?
>>Upgrading would be a nighmare fom me, I am targeting an embedded platform.
>
> Disable CONFIG_VT_CONSOLE, and the console messages will no longer be printed
> to the frame buffer. You still have a console though, i.e. you can still print
> to /dev/ttyX if you want.
>
> If you don't want to provide console drawing operations, just set
> display->dispsw to &dispsw_dummy.
>
> Gr{oetje,eeting}s,
I found no dispsw_dummy, do you mean fbcon_dummy?
Thanks foy the reply, that seems to be the solution I was looking for.
